Court issues summons to TAPE, GMA for alleged  copyright infringement and unfair competition
Tito Sotto, Vic Sotto, and Joey de Leon (left), collectively known as TVJ, together with Jeny Ferre (not in photo), filed copyright infringement and unfair competition complaints against GMA Network, Inc. and TAPE Inc., producer of noontime show 'Eat Bulaga!.'

Naglabas ng summons ang Branch 273 ng Marikina Regional Trial Court upang hingin ang sagot ng TAPE Inc., at GMA Network, Inc. kaugnay ng inihaing copyright infringement at unfair competition complaints nina Tito Sotto, Vic Sotto, Joey de Leon, at Jeny Ferre.

Kaugnay ito ng paggamit ng titulong "Eat Bulaga!".

Sina Tito, Vic, at Joey ang original hosts ng longest-running noontime show sa Pilipinas, ang Eat Bulaga!, na ipinuprodyus ng TAPE at umeere sa GMA-7.

Si Jeny ang dating Executive Vice-President for Production ng TAPE, na pagmamay-ari nina Romeo Jalosjos Sr. at Tony Tuviera.

Ang reklamo ay may docket na SSC Case No. 2023-37-MK.

Nakasaad sa docket ng reklamo, “Copyright Infringement and Unfair Competition under R.A. No. 8293, otherwise known as the Intelectual Property Code of the Philippines, with Application for Issuance of a Writ of Preliminary Injunction.”

Ito naman ang nilalaman ng summon, “GREETINGS. You are hereby required, within thirty (30) days after service of this Summons to file with this court and serve on the plaintiffs, through counsel, you Answer to the Complaint, copy of which is attached together with the answers.

“You are reminded of Rule 2, Section 4 of the 2020 Revised Rules of Procedure for Intellectual Property Rights Cases which proscribed the filing of a motion to dismiss except only on the grounds of lack of jurisdiction over the subject matter, litis pendentia, or res judicata, and instead allege any ground/s other than the ones previously mentioned as defense/s in the Answer.

“If you fail to answer within the time fixed, the court, on motion of the plaintiffs, or motu proprio, render judgement as may be warranted by the allegations in the complaint, as well as the affidavits and other evidence on record.

“WITNESS, the Honorable Judge ROMEO DIZON TAGRA, Presiding Judge of this Court, this 10th of July 2023, at Marikina City, Metro Manila, Philippines."

Pirmado ang naturang summon ni Eunice Bisnar, Acting Court Legal Researcher.

TAPE LAWYER STATEMENT

Ayon naman sa legal counsel ng TAPE na si Atty. Maggie Abraham-Garduque, in-aknowlegde ng Intelectual Property Office (IPO) na sila ang “prior registrant” ng pangalang Eat Bulaga!.

Nakasaad sa statement na ipinadala niya sa Philippine Entertainment Portal (PEP.ph) ngayong Miyerkules ng umaga, July 11, “IPO acknowldeges that TAPE is the prior registrant of Trademark ‘Eat Bulaga,’ advised TAPE to file protection of trademark ownership before the IPO, Bureau of Legal Affairs.

“In a letter reply of IPO to the April 25, 2023 letter of TAPE, Inc., IPO recognized that TAPE, Inc. is the prior registrant of trademark, Eat Bulaga!.

“Said letter was filed by the president and CEO of TAPE, Inc. on April 25 when TAPE learned the March 22, 2023 application of Joey de Leon.”

Ayon pa sa legal counsel ng TAPE, “Yes, it was during that time that TAPE learned that trademarks were filed by TVJ, Tito Sotto, and Joey de Leon on February 27, 2023 and March 22, 2023.

“TAPE promptly asserts its prior ownership thereof being the prior registrant thereof.”

Noong panahong nag-file ang TVJ ng trademark claims, wala pang abogado ang TAPE kaya hindi sila nakapag-file ng tamang application sa IPO.

Pinayuhan din daw ng IPO ang TAPE na kumuha ng abogado.

Hanggang ngayon, ang original theme song ng Eat Bulaga! ang gamit ng noontime show ng TVJ sa TV5 na E.A.T. pero tinanggal ang "Bulaga."
